Dance a part of Lucy's active life Lucy is member of a large family – parent Pip and William have six daughters. Lucy has a rare chromosome disorder, the chromosome Q13 deletion, a condition which affects only four others in New Zealand and about 150 people worldwide. Lucy is profoundly deaf with no verbal communication and she lives with autism, hyperactivity and OCD. Lucy has a team of three support workers on rostered shifts. Green fingers get to work in the greenhouse Rebecca is a gardening enthusiast who is turning her passion into a sustainable business. As a recipient of a Fund for Good grant, Rebecca grows vegetables to sell at a local produce market. Living with her parents in Southland, her Dad Neville provides support while Mum Dianne works full-time.
